Historicity Solomon

historical evidence of king solomon other biblical accounts has been minimal scholars have understood period of reign dark age (muhly 1998). josephus in against apion, citing tyrian court records , menander, gives specific year during king hiram of tyre sent materials solomon construction of temple. however, no material evidence indisputably of solomon s reign has been found. yigael yadin s excavations @ hazor, megiddo, beit shean , gezer uncovered structures , others have argued date solomon s reign, others, such israel finkelstein , neil silberman, argue should dated omride period, more century after solomon.

according finkelstein , silberman, authors of bible unearthed: archaeology s new vision of ancient israel , origin of sacred texts, @ time of kingdoms of david , solomon, jerusalem populated few hundred residents or less, insufficient empire stretching euphrates eilath. according bible unearthed, archaeological evidence suggests kingdom of israel @ time of solomon little more small city state, , implausible solomon received tribute large 666 talents of gold per year. although both finkelstein , silberman accept david , solomon real inhabitants of judah 10th century bce, claim earliest independent reference kingdom of israel 890 bce, , judah 750 bce. suggest because of religious prejudice, authors of bible suppressed achievements of omrides (whom hebrew bible describes being polytheist), , instead pushed them supposed golden age of judaism , monotheists, , devotees of yahweh. biblical minimalists thomas l. thompson go further, arguing jerusalem became city , capable of being state capital in mid-7th century. likewise, finkelstein , others consider claimed size of solomon s temple implausible.


these views criticized william g. dever, , andré lemaire, among others. lemaire states in ancient israel: abraham roman destruction of temple principal points of biblical tradition of solomon trustworthy, although elsewhere writes find no substantiating archaeological evidence supports queen of sheba s visit king solomon, saying earliest records of trans-arabian caravan voyages tayma , sheba unto middle-euphrates &c. occurred in mid-8th century bce, placing possible visit queen of sheba jerusalem around time – 250 years later timeframe traditionally given king solomon s reign. kenneth kitchen argues solomon ruled on comparatively wealthy mini-empire , rather small city-state, , considers 666 gold talents modest amount of money. kitchen calculates on 30 years, such kingdom might have accumulated 500 tons of gold, small compared other examples, such 1,180 tons of gold alexander great took susa. kitchen , others consider temple of solomon reasonable , typically sized structure region @ time. dever states have direct bronze , iron age parallels every feature of solomonic temple described in hebrew bible .


some scholars have charted middle path between minimalist scholars finkelstein, silberman, , philip davies (who believes “solomon totally invented character”) on 1 hand, , maximalist scholars dever, lemaire, , kitchen on other hand. instance, archaeologist avraham faust has argued biblical depictions of solomon date later periods , overstate wealth, buildings, , kingdom, solomon did have acropolis , ruled on polity larger jerusalem. in particular, archaeological research in regions near jerusalem, sharon, finds commerce great not supported polity , such regions ruled loosely jerusalem. scholars lester grabbe believe there must have been ruler in jerusalem during period , built temple, although town quite small.


the archaeological remains considered date time of solomon notable fact canaanite material culture appears have continued unabated; there distinct lack of magnificent empire, or cultural development – indeed comparing pottery areas traditionally assigned israel of philistines points latter having been more sophisticated. however, there lack of physical evidence of existence, despite archaeological work in area. not unexpected because area devastated babylonians, rebuilt , destroyed several times. little archaeological excavation has been done around area known temple mount, in thought foundation of solomon s temple, because attempts met protest muslims.


from critical point of view, solomon s building of temple yahweh should not considered act of particular devotion yahweh because solomon described building places of worship number of other deities. scholars , historians argue solomon s apparent initial devotion yahweh, described in passages such dedication prayer (1 kings 8:14–66), written later, after jerusalem had become religious centre of kingdom, replacing locations such shiloh , bethel. scholars believe passages such these in books of kings not written same authors wrote rest of text, instead deuteronomist. such views have been challenged other historians maintain there evidence these passages in kings derived official court records @ time of solomon , other writings of time incorporated canonical books of kings.


the biblical passages understand tarshish source of king solomon s great wealth in metals – silver, gold, tin , iron (ezekiel 27) – linked archaeological evidence silver-hoards found in phoenicia in 2013. metals tarshish reportedly obtained solomon in partnership king hiram of phoenician tyre (isaiah 23), , fleets of tarshish-ships sailed in service, , silver-hoards provide first recognized material evidence agrees ancient texts concerning solomon s kingdom , wealth (see wealth below).


possible evidence described wealth of solomon , kingdom discovered in ancient silver-hoards, found in israel , phoenicia , recognized importance in 2003. evidence hoards shows levant center of wealth in precious metals during reign of solomon , hiram, , matches texts trade extended asia atlantic ocean.


chronology

the conventional dates of solomon s reign derived biblical chronology c. 970 931 bce. regarding davidic dynasty king solomon belongs, chronology can checked against datable babylonian , assyrian records @ few points, , these correspondences have allowed archeologists date kings in modern framework. according used chronology, based on edwin r. thiele, death of solomon , division of kingdom have occurred in spring of 931 bce.
